Sec[Section] 1 Be it enacted by the people of the State of Illinois represented in the General Assembly, That it shall be lawfull for the Commissioners of the Board of Public works, and the Board of Commissioners of the Illinois and Michigan Canal to act in conjunction and adopt and execute measures to bring into the State labourers to be employed on the Canal and works of Internal Improvements in the state, said boards shall take such measures in acting under the provisions of this act, as will prevent any and all loss to the State in consequence thereof and this act, shall not be executed unless the two boards shall be satisfied that the interest of the State will be promoted thereby
